Overview: The AMERLIFE 10×10×8.5 FT Pop-up Greenhouse delivers impressive scale for serious gardeners seeking portable protection. This walk-in structure offers 116 square feet of growing space with a peak height of 8.5 feet, accommodating tall plants and comfortable movement. Designed for rapid deployment, its collapsible frame sets up in minutes without tools, while height-adjustable columns adapt to various plant species throughout the growing season.

What Makes It Stand Out: The adjustable height columns differentiate this from static models, allowing customization for tomatoes, fruit trees, or seedlings. Heavy-duty spiral ground pegs, metal plugs, and nylon rope connections provide superior stability compared to basic pop-ups. The reinforced PE cover with transparent PVC panels balances durability with light transmission, while dual roll-up doors and mesh windows optimize ventilation for climate control.

Value for Money: While priced higher than compact alternatives, this greenhouse costs significantly less than permanent structures. The multi-purpose design—doubling as an event tent—adds versatility that justifies the investment for users needing seasonal flexibility. Comparable sized permanent greenhouses run 3-5x more, making this an economical choice for renters or experimental gardeners testing location and crops before committing to a fixed installation.

Strengths and Weaknesses: Strengths include generous space, tool-free setup, adjustable height, and robust anchoring system. The waterproof PE cover performs well in moderate weather. Weaknesses involve potential wind vulnerability despite reinforcements, limited warranty information, and PE material degradation under intense UV exposure over 2-3 years. The storage bag, while convenient, may not withstand frequent transport.

Bottom Line: Ideal for dedicated gardeners needing substantial, flexible growing space without permanent installation. It excels for seasonal use and diverse plant heights, though anchoring it properly in windy locations remains essential for long-term satisfaction.

Overview: The EAGLE PEAK 8×6 FT Instant Pop-up Greenhouse targets intermediate gardeners prioritizing durability and convenience. This walk-in structure provides 48 square feet of protected growing space with a patented center-lock frame that deploys in seconds. The powder-coated steel construction offers reliable year-round protection for backyard vegetables, herbs, and flowers across challenging weather conditions without requiring permanent foundations.

What Makes It Stand Out: Patented center lock technology enables genuine one-person setup without frustration. The heavy-duty steel frame uses more material than competitors, delivering noticeable stability. A 1-year limited warranty covering both frame and cover exceeds industry standards where fabric is typically excluded. The design accommodates custom shelving (sold separately), maximizing vertical growing potential efficiently in the compact footprint.

Value for Money: Positioned in the mid-range price segment, this greenhouse balances cost with professional-grade construction. The warranty adds tangible value, potentially saving replacement costs. While more expensive than basic models, its robust frame justifies the premium over flimsier alternatives that fail within one season. Permanent structures of similar size cost 4-6x more, making this a smart intermediate investment.

Strengths and Weaknesses: Strengths include lightning-fast setup, sturdy rust-resistant frame, UV-protective PE cover, and comprehensive warranty. Mesh windows and roll-up doors provide excellent ventilation. Weaknesses include the need to purchase shelving separately, limited size for ambitious gardeners, and PE cover longevity concerns in extreme climates. The 8×6 footprint may feel cramped when fully stocked with mature plants.

Bottom Line: An excellent choice for reliable, no-fuss gardening. The warranty and sturdy frame make it worth the modest premium, particularly for gardeners in variable climates seeking peace of mind and quick seasonal deployment.

Overview: The Porayhut Pop-Up Greenhouse Tent redefines portability for casual gardeners. Measuring just 37×37×48 inches and weighing 6.6 pounds, this ultra-compact shelter provides targeted protection for prized potted plants or small herb collections. Its fold-down design collapses to a 2.36-inch thick package, making it ideal for renters, balcony gardeners, or anyone needing temporary frost protection without permanent infrastructure or significant storage space.

What Makes It Stand Out: Extreme lightweight design and 600D Oxford cloth construction set it apart from typical PE-covered models. The double-layer PE mesh fabric offers improved insulation over single-layer alternatives. At under $100 typically, it democratizes greenhouse gardening for budget-conscious buyers. The arched roof design prevents snow accumulation, a thoughtful detail often missing in mini greenhouses that extends its seasonal usefulness.

Value for Money: This is among the most affordable protective plant solutions available. While limited in capacity, it costs a fraction of permanent or even standard pop-up greenhouses. For gardeners primarily needing seasonal frost protection rather than year-round growing, it delivers exceptional ROI. The portability eliminates installation costs entirely—simply unfold and stake, making it accessible to those without DIY skills.

Strengths and Weaknesses: Strengths include incredible portability, lightweight storage, affordability, and adequate insulation for overwintering container plants. The roll-up door and screen windows provide basic ventilation. Weaknesses involve minimal growing space, low height restricting plant size, questionable long-term durability of lightweight materials, and limited stability in wind despite 7-shaped ground stakes. The 37-inch width barely accommodates two large pots.

Bottom Line: Best suited for casual gardeners protecting a few container plants through winter. It fills a niche for ultra-portable frost protection but cannot support serious growing ambitions or function as a true walk-in greenhouse despite marketing claims.

Common Mistakes to Avoid When Buying

Overlooking Your Growing Zone

The most frequent error is purchasing based on size and features without considering your USDA Hardiness Zone. Zone 3 gardeners need different insulation and snow-load capabilities than Zone 9 growers. Many 2026 models are zone-optimized, with northern versions featuring more robust insulation and southern variants prioritizing ventilation and shade features. Check the zone rating on the product specifications—using a Zone 7 greenhouse in Zone 4 will result in frozen plants and wasted money, while a Zone 4 model in Zone 9 will overheat constantly.

Ignoring Wind Patterns in Your Yard

Even EF2-rated greenhouses fail when placed in wind tunnels. Before buying, spend time observing how wind flows through your property during storms. Pop-up greenhouses perform best when oriented with the narrow end facing prevailing winds and positioned behind windbreaks like fences or shrubs. Some 2026 models include wind rose analysis in their app, using your phone’s GPS and local weather data to recommend optimal placement. Ignoring this step can turn your instant greenhouse into an instant kite.

Underestimating Space Requirements

The deployed footprint is just the beginning. You need 3 feet of clearance on all sides for ventilation, access, and emergency egress. Interior space needs are equally misunderstood—while a 8x8 foot greenhouse offers 64 square feet, walkways, shelving, and workspace reduce usable growing area by 40%. Use the AR planning tools most manufacturers now provide to virtually place the greenhouse and visualize how you’ll move inside it. Remember, it’s better to have slightly too much space than to be cramped among your tomatoes.
